Soquel, July 28, 2025 -

A traffic collision occurred today on Soquel San Jose Road in Soquel, CA, involving a single vehicle that struck both a fence and a metal barrier. The incident took place around 8:52 PM, prompting a rapid response from emergency services. Units arrived promptly to manage the scene and coordinate traffic control measures.

As a result of the collision, adjustments were made to the metal barrier, and lane management was implemented to ensure the safety of all motorists. While specific delays were not reported, the traffic incident required temporary lane closures, which may have affected the flow of traffic in the area.

Emergency responders worked efficiently to clear the scene, with a tow truck arriving to assist in removing the vehicle involved in the crash. By late evening, the roadway was cleared, allowing normal traffic patterns to resume.
